HIP 84703

HIP 84703 is a F-type (Yellow-White) star.

At a distance of roughly 1,022 light-years, HIP 84703 is a distant star lying deep within the Milky Way galaxy.

HIP 84703 is classified as a spectral class F star (F-type (Yellow-White)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.

HIP 84703 has an apparent magnitude of +8.60, placing it beyond naked-eye visibility. A good pair of binoculars or a small telescope is required to observe this star. Observers will note its white h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of +0.383.
